arterial blood gas

Definitions

from The American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, 5th Edition.

  • noun The concentration of oxygen and carbon dioxide in the blood, whose partial pressures are measured along with other factors such as blood pH in order to assess oxygen saturation and other metabolic indicators in patients, especially those with respiratory disorders.

from Wiktionary, Creative Commons Attribution/Share-Alike License.

  • noun A blood test in which a syringe is used to draw a small blood sample from an artery.
